Buying a Cabin Bed Single

If your children are sharing rooms or you want to add some storage space in their bedrooms, cabin beds and mid sleepers are an excellent choice. They're also great for unexpected sleepovers!

The beds of a cabin are generally higher off the ground than the standard beds, either bunk or single, and are accessible via ladder. They are often fitted with storage options that can help keep the space around them tidy and organised.

Built-in Storage Options

Cabin beds are perfect for small spaces because they are built-in storage. These are usually hidden away under the elevated sleeping area, so they do not take up valuable floor space. This is particularly useful when your child's room is messy, because you can store things and clutter in a tidy manner.

The space beneath the raised bed is also a great place for your child to read or play games. Certain models, like the Maxxi Cabin Bed with Slide include slides so that your children can start their day with a whizz and whoosh!

Some beds, like the Alfie Modular Middle Sleeper Bed, are adaptable to allow you to include more storage space as your child grows. This includes a tent, desk and slides. They can create a cozy place under the bed for playing or cosying up with books.

There are a variety of cabin beds to choose from and it's crucial to think about your child's needs and the style of their room before making a purchase. High-sleepers, for instance are not suited for children with small bodies due to safety issues. A single bed is a better choice.

Whatever type of cabin bed you pick, it's important to keep in mind that safety should be your primary concern when choosing furniture for your children. Most experts recommend waiting until a child is at least 4 to 6 years old before introducing the loft or high sleeper. It's also crucial to assess your child's ability to climb up and down the elevated sleeping area safely.

Comfortable Mattresses

A comfortable mattress is an essential component of any cabin bed single. The best mattresses offer superior support and are available in various levels of firmness. The ideal choice depends on the body weight of the sleeper and preferred sleeping position. Mattresses with soft cushions are ideal for side sleepers as they provide cushioning to their hips, shoulders, and backs. Medium-firm mattresses are best for back and stomach sleepers.

Before you purchase a mattress ensure that the mattress you pick will fit in the frame of your cabin bed. The mattress's size should be measured to ensure it is perfectly, and make sure the frame has no pinch points. If you're using a loft or bunk bed, ensure any doors and drawers for storage open without catching the mattress. Make sure that the guardrails are at least 5 inches above the mattress to avoid falls and injuries.

Also, consider an opportunity to test the mattress to make sure the mattress is a perfect match. Many brands offer a trial period of up to a month. This lets you test the mattress in your bedroom and return it if not happy. Some brands will take it to donate.
